Biography
Nyoman Loka Suara is a painter born in Bali, on February 13, 1970. He studied fine arts at ISI Bali. Since 1993, he has been active in various joint exhibitions, including the Palette group exhibition at Come Out Festival Australia (1998), Beijing International Art Biennale, China (2015), and Asian Art Biennale II, Hong Kong (2017). He is also a member of the Militant Arts Community of Fine Arts.

I am not a very productive artist. It does not mean to say that I do not have jobs I have work. But even by my measure, I am not as productive as many other artists that I know. I am unable to create work day in and day out. I am only able to create works when there is something niggling at me and I have something to say. Something I am curious about. This is my character.
Loka Suara

Art and Appetitte
I do not like to paint something that is burdened by issues of composition. I like to have a free space, its like one table with too many options to eat you can lose your appetitie. Sometimes just with one type of food, it can really whett your appetite.
Loka Suara

“He is a thinker. One does not always see it. He has a way of seeing things in a very contemporary way but behind it, it is never separate from the roots of his traditional heritage. Slow but quick. He is a paradox in a way. When nothing is getting his interest he is slow. You can see him sitting down and just being quite still. But then when it’s the moment, he’s right in the moment and will move quickly in that moment.” ~ Agus Kama Loedin
